Raqesh Bapat is an Indian actor, model, and visual artist who works primarily in Hindi television and films. He gained popular recognition through his role in the Marathi-Hindi feature film Tum Bin (2001) and later through several Hindi television serials. He is also known for his work as a painter and sculptor, and for his appearance on the reality show Bigg Boss OTT in 2021.

Raqesh Bapat was born and brought up in Pune, Maharashtra. He pursued an interest in fine arts alongside his entry into modelling and acting. He has continued to work as a sculptor and painter throughout his acting career, exhibiting his art in addition to his on-screen work.
Bapat made his Hindi film debut with Anubhav Sinha's romantic drama Tum Bin (2001), in which he played the role of Amar opposite Sandali Sinha and Priyanshu Chatterjee. The film became a sleeper hit and remains his best-known cinema appearance. He has subsequently appeared in select Marathi films and independent projects.

In 2021, Bapat participated in Bigg Boss OTT, the digital edition of the Bigg Boss franchise hosted by Karan Johar on Voot. He was paired in the show's connection format with actor Shamita Shetty. He left the house mid-season due to a health issue but later re-entered as a guest. He subsequently appeared with Shamita Shetty in the music video Tere Bin Kya Hai Jeena.
Apart from acting, Bapat is an established sculptor working with materials including wood and metal. He has spoken in multiple interviews about regarding sculpture as a parallel and equally significant career to acting.
Bapat married Marathi and Hindi television actor Ridhi Dogra in 2011. The couple announced their separation in 2019.
